Delivery Manager UK&I
The Delivery Manager will report directly to the UK&I Professional Services Director and be an integral part of the UK&I PS Management team. This is a senior role with line management responsibility for a designated team and responsibility for increasing customer satisfaction, improving adoption, and owning retention within the portfolio of UK&I customers. The Delivery Manager will be closely aligned with our core product and services teams to deliver solutions based on standard delivery programs, methods and processes to service our customers. The Delivery Manager will work with the UK&I PS Director to set clear objectives for their team, provide thought leadership in the organization, as well as, execute strategies and programs that will drive growth and customer success. He/she will be responsible to ensure successful customer engagements, maintain high customer satisfaction, and articulate the value delivered through project and program delivery.
Success in the Role: What are the performance outcomes over the first 6-12 months you will work toward completing?
During the first year, you will onboard into the role, understand the portfolio, build out your network and then work with your assigned customers in order to maximise their success.

What is the leadership like for this role? What is the structure and culture of the team like?
The successful candidate will report to the UK&I Professional Services Director. The Professional Services Consulting team is focused on Architecting, Deploying, and helping our strategic customers get the most from their investment in VMware by Broadcom technology. Along with the rest of the Professional Services business we are critical to the success of VMware by Broadcom and celebrate our role in the future of the company. We strive to have a diverse, but unified team, one which is entirely focused on our customers and their success. We do the right thing for the customer so when our customers achieve their outcomes, we are successful too. We are an open team who share best practice, and everyone wants their colleagues to succeed and to develop a meaningful career and network within VMware by Broadcom and the industry. We support each other and want to give back to each other and our communities so welcome innovation and creativity at all levels to be a meaningful contributor in our countries and societies.
Where is this role located?
Remote/On-site: The successful candidate will be based in England. Working will be a mix of working from Customer sites and home with monthly meetings in the London office to meet with peers and business partners.
